![FreeBSD 10.2에 대한 HAST 동기화가 완료되었습니다.](https://linux55.com/image/83803/FreeBSD%2010.2%EC%97%90%20%EB%8C%80%ED%95%9C%20HAST%20%EB%8F%99%EA%B8%B0%ED%99%94%EA%B0%80%20%EC%99%84%EB%A3%8C%EB%90%98%EC%97%88%EC%8A%B5%EB%8B%88%EB%8B%A4..png)
이것수동설명하다:
출력에서 상태 줄을 확인하세요. 다운그레이드가 표시되면 구성 파일에 문제가 있는 것입니다. 각 노드에 완료가 표시되어야 합니다. 이는 노드 간 동기화가 시작되었음을 의미합니다.hastctl 상태가 0바이트의 더티 범위를 보고하면 동기화가 완료된 것입니다.. [강조하다]
Google에서 검색할 때 초기 버전은 hastctl status
"더티" 필드를 포함하여 많은 정보를 제공하는 것 같습니다. 예를 들어:
role: primary
provname: mirror
localpath: /dev/da0s2
extentsize: 2097152
keepdirty: 64
remoteaddr: 192.168.0.2
replication: memsync
status: complete
dirty: 17142120448 bytes
그러나 이것을 입력하면 다음과 같은 결과 hastctl status
가 나타납니다.
myhast complete primary /dev/gpt/hast 192.168.1.2
정보가 훨씬 적습니다. 여러 -d
옵션을 추가하는 것은 도움이 되지 않는 것 같습니다.
FreeBSD HAST 설정에 보조 노드를 추가할 때 보조 노드의 동기화가 언제 완료되는지 어떻게 알 수 있나요?
답변1
그것을 발견. 이제 해당 정보는 다음을 통해 제공되는 것으로 보입니다.hastctl list
myhast:
role: primary
provname: myhast
localpath: /dev/gpt/hast
extentsize: 2097152 (2.0MB)
keepdirty: 64
remoteaddr: 192.168.1.2
replication: memsync
status: complete
workerpid: 1540
dirty: 0 (0B)
statistics:
reads: 1216
writes: 24814
deletes: 0
flushes: 0
activemap updates: 736
local errors: read: 0, write: 0, delete: 0, flush: 0
queues: local: 0, send: 0, recv: 0, done: 0, idle: 255